    Kenwood/Pioneer Double Din HU’s

    Does anyone know a quick way to distinguish the 6.2” HU’s from the 6.75” and larger? My truck already has a Metra kit for a 6.2”, so I’d like to narrow my search to only those, but a lot of the info just says double din. Is there a certain number that differentiates the 6.2” from the larger units?

    Im looking for 6.2”, CD, Bluetooth, hands free, front aux, front usb, Pandora, iPhone compatibility, and 2 sets of RCA preouts required. Doesn’t have to be touchscreen, and would prefer a volume knob.

    Re: Kenwood/Pioneer Double Din HU’s

    On most Kenwood’s, the 6.2” has the CD slot visible above the screen and buttons to the left, the 6.95” has the CD slot behind the screen and buttons on the bottom. There might be one with the bigger screen with smaller buttons to the left. The chassis are the same size, so they should work in the same kits. Only hang up could be if the screen is motorized. This only applies to touchscreen radios. All the non-touchscreen ones should all be the same sizes unless it’s a strange off brand.

    Re: Kenwood/Pioneer Double Din HU’s

    Yes, any Kenwood double DIN radio should fit in that kit, only thing that could be a hang up is if it has a motorized face and slightly drug on the bottom of the kit opening. If that happened, it could be remedied with a bit of filing.
